      #### Early Career and Achievements

      Annalisa Marckmann, a sophomore at Northeastern University, has already demonstrated a remarkable talent for track and field. Her journey began with a strong foundation in multiple events, showcasing her adaptability and potential for greatness. At the Sean Collier Invitational, she ran a 14.93 in the 100-meter hurdles, securing second place and setting a personal best in the process[3].

      #### CAA Outdoor Track and Field Championships

      At the CAA Outdoor Track and Field Championships in May 2024, Marckmann continued to impress. She finished 10th in the heptathlon with a score of 4031 points, demonstrating her endurance and all-around athletic ability. In the 100-meter hurdles, she clocked a time of 15.05 seconds (1.1 meters per second wind), securing fifth place. Additionally, she cleared 1.33 meters (4 feet 4.25 inches) in the high jump, placing 16th, and threw 9.80 meters (32 feet 2 inches) in the shot put, finishing seventh[4].

      #### Personal Bests and Records

      Marckmann has consistently set personal bests across various events. At the Sean Collier Invitational, she achieved a personal best in the long jump with a leap of 5.00 meters. She also set a new personal best in the javelin throw, showcasing her strength and technique in this event[3].
